Quite frankly, I’d like to move in permanently. Our room was huge, well-furnished and with extremely comfortable futons. Plenty of wardrobe space as well which we’ve found a rarity in Japanese accommodation. The private toilet, wash basin and shower are all in separate areas so it’s easy for different occupants of the room to be doing different things. Lovely yukata and happi coats provided for the stay. We had half board and the evening meal was outstanding with multiple dishes, all beautifully presented. Breakfast was good as well with a few western-style dishes alongside the Japanese ones. Plus there are onsens for guest use including an outdoor one that was just bliss in the chilly evening. I haven’t mentioned the staff. Unfailingly courteous and helpful and most of the ones we met were kind enough to speak excellent English. We stayed in October, outside the ski season, and thought it phenomenally good value. I would really love to be able to stay again.

The room was much bigger than I anticipated, and in a Japanese style (with tatami) so I was pleasantly surprised. The onsen in the hotel was an absolute delight. It had several baths with different temperatures, a lounge space, a sauna, a cold bath (which can be rare), and of course everything needed to wash yourself thoroughly before going into the baths. The hotel also provides body towels as well as face towels, so you don't need to bring yours. They have lockers to keep your items safe while bathing. There's free breakfast (little pieces of bread + some juice and coffee/tea) and a space on the first floor to relax after the onsen for example. It has wifi there as well.

The monkeys are marvellous. Of course they are attracted to the valley by the food they receive regularly but they are totally free to come and go. So entertaining and endearing to observe how they interact. The park was created in 1964. Beautiful forest in a mountainous area that grows apples, peaches and grapes and lots of vegetables.
